Taking
place at the beginning of the Shinseiki
Evangelion television serial, Gendou Ikari
hands you the responsibility of live-in teacher to
Rei Ayanami. When you first meet her, she's pretty
banged up with bandages all over and her arm's
cradled by a sling. Similar to but not quite a blank
slate, your young charge is recovering from injuries
and it's up to you to help her heal mentally and
physically. With a set of six primary commands such
as "talk," "goods," "costume," "town," and
"schedule," you'll give Rei various duties to
perform and gradually win her confidence.
Ayanami's day can consist of going to school, learning archery to
improve her willpower, playing violin, or a trip to
the amusement park, among other venues. Each
activity improves or diminishes one or more of her
attributes. Along the way, you'll get to see Ayanami
in various pieces of clothing including a kimono and
something that might be worn to a luau. In Asuka's
episode, she can dress up in a pink 2-piece bikini,
a sports outfit, a barmaid costume, and a school
uniform.
The Nintendo DS conversion of Evangelion
Ayanami Ikusei Keikaku is based on the Playstation
2 game which includes a scenario featuring Asuka
Langley and increases the number of possible endings
to a total of 50 rather than the 30 found in the
original Dreamcast version. The NDS game also
includes a bonus quiz game that tests the player's
knowledge of Evangelion. Rei, Shinji, and Asuka
stand behind podiums and answer multiple choice
questions that appear on the touch screen.
